Warning Signs You Need Clean Water Extraction (Category 1) in Plymouth, MN

Don’t wait until it’s too late to address water damage on your property. Catching these signs early can save you money and prevent bigger problems. Here are some warning signs that you need our clean water extraction services: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ong, persistent odors can be a sign of water damage or mold growth. If you notice musty smells in your property, it’s essential to investigate further. Don’t ignore the signs.

Visible Water Damage

Water stains, warping, or buckling of surfaces can be a clear sign of water damage. If you notice any of these signs, it’s crucial to act quickly. Don’t delay, call us now.

Discoloration or Warping

Changes in color or texture of surfaces can be a sign of water damage. If you notice discoloration or warping, it’s essential to investigate further. We’ll help you identify the issue.

Peeling Paint or Wallpaper

Peeling paint or wallpaper can be a sign of water damage or high humidity. If you notice these signs, it’s crucial to address the issue quickly. Don’t let it get worse.

Unexplained Leaks or Water Spots

Unexplained leaks or water spots can be a sign of a larger issue. If you notice these signs, it’s essential to investigate further. We’ll help you find the source of the problem.

Clean Water Extraction (Category 1) Cost in Plymouth, MN

With clean water extraction costs, it’s essential to understand that prices can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Plymouth, MN. These are estimated costs, not guarantees, and may vary based on your specific situation. We’ll provide a free estimate after assessing your property.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Initial Assessment and Planning $500 – $2,500 Severity of damage, size of affected area, and complexity of the job.
Water Extraction $1,000 – $5,000 Amount of water, type of equipment required, and number of personnel needed.
Drying and Dehumidification $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, type of equipment required, and number of personnel needed.
Cleaning and Sanitizing $1,000 – $3,000 Size of affected area, type of equipment required, and number of personnel needed.

What types of water damage do you handle?

We specialize in clean water extraction, also known as Category 1 water damage. This type of damage typically occurs from broken appliances, burst pipes, or overflowing sinks. We’ll handle the water damage with the latest equipment and techniques.
